0

アプリケーションの多くの場所でサーバーの URL を使用しています。変更する必要がある場合は、変更に使用したすべての場所に移動する必要があります。

どこでも使用でき、あまり変更を必要としないように、URL を宣言するのに最適な場所はどこですか?

4

1 に答える 1

1

RhoConfig.xml ファイルでサーバー URL をプロパティとして宣言できます。その後、API 呼び出し中にプロパティ値を取得します。

したがって、RhoConfig.xml でプロパティを削除するには、そのように追加する必要があります。

   start_path = '/app'
   options_path = '/app/Settings'
   server_URL = 'http://somedomain.com/API/'

コントローラーで server_URL の値を取得するには、Rho::RhoConfig クラスを呼び出して、以下のように使用する必要があります。

   if Rho::RhoConfig.exists?('server_URL')
       $server_url = Rho::RhoConfig.server_URL
   end 

これにより、必要に応じて URL が 1 か所で変更されます。

于 2013-09-16T04:41:36.287 に答える